Country area

The surface area of France is 210 026 mi², while the surface area of Greenland is 836 330 mi². This means that the area of Greenland is 298% larger.

Coastline length

France has a coastline of 3 015.5 mi, while Greenland has a coastline of 27 394.4 mi.

Largest city

The largest city in France is Paris, with a population of about 2 241 350 people. In contrast, the largest city in Greenland is Nuuk, where the population is 16 454.

Highest peak

The highest peak in France is Mont Blanc, its height is 15 781 ft. The highest peak in Greenland is Gunnbjørn Fjeld, which rises to a height of 12 119 ft.

Highest recorded temperature

In France, the highest temperature ever measured was 111.4°F and was recorded in Conqueyrac / Saint-Christol-les-Ales, while in Greenland the highest temperature was 78.6°F and was recorded in Maniitsoq.

Lowest recorded temperature

In France, the lowest temperature ever measured was -41.8°F and was recorded in Mouthe, Doubs, while in Greenland, the lowest temperature was -87°F and was recorded in North Ice.

Population

The population of France is about 65 273 511, while Greenland is home to 56 770 people.

Life expectancy

Life expectancy is 82.4 years in France and 73.7 years in Greenland.

Language

In France, the main language is French, and in Greenland the primary language is Kalaallisut.

Electricity

Electricity in France: frequency and voltage are 230V 50 Hz (plug type: C, E). Electricity in Greenland: frequency and voltage are 230V 50 Hz (plug type: C, E, F, K).
